CBN Governor Cardoso Honoured as Central Bank of the Year in London
Nigeria’s Central Bank Governor, Olayemi Cardoso, received the Central Bank of the Year Award at a ceremony in London. He dedicated the honour to the board, management and staff of the apex bank for their commitment to institutional reform and economic stability. Cardoso highlighted key measures taken by the CBN, including efforts to curb inflation, foreign exchange reforms and investments in digital and financial infrastructure. He also noted milestones such as Nigeria’s removal from the FATF grey list and the successful banking sector recapitalisation. The governor expressed optimism about ongoing reforms and reaffirmed the bank’s dedication to public confidence and sustainable growth.
